Explain what caused the movement to write the United States Constitution as a replacement for the Articles of Confederation.​
MrRa [10]
The Articles created a loose confederation of sovereign states and a weak central government, leaving most of the power with the state governments. The need for a stronger Federal government soon became apparent and eventually led to the Constitutional Convention in 1787.

By the 1700s, Pennsylvania became one of the<br> most famous and popular destinations because
Molodets [167]
Peaceful relations with neighboring American Indian groups and fertile farmland helped Penn's experiment become a success. Philadelphia grew into one of the most important cities in colonial America, becoming the birthplace of the U.S. Constitution.
